State Machine Examination

Algorithm

A State Machine Examination, within cryptocurrency and derivatives, assesses the deterministic progression of a trading system or protocol through defined states, triggered by specific market events or internal conditions. This examination focuses on verifying the logical consistency and predictable behavior of the system’s core execution pathways, crucial for risk management and auditability. The process involves rigorous testing of state transitions, ensuring accurate order execution, collateral adjustments, and settlement procedures, particularly in complex decentralized finance (DeFi) applications. Consequently, a thorough algorithmic review identifies potential vulnerabilities related to manipulation or unintended consequences within the system’s operational logic.